Why is a countdown significant during rocket launches?

A countdown is significant during rocket launches because it serves as a critical safety and operational procedure. It helps ensure that all individuals involved in the launch, including the ground crew and observers, are prepared and in a safe position before ignition. This systematic approach allows for checks and confirmations of all systems, safety measures, and readiness status, minimizing the risk of accidents or malfunctions during the launch process.

While it may create excitement among spectators, that is a secondary benefit rather than the primary purpose of the countdown. Similarly, the countdown does not adjust the rocket's trajectory or serve as a method to record launch data. Its main focus is on assuring that all necessary safety protocols and procedures are followed, ultimately prioritizing the well-being of both the launch crew and the spectators.
